Why (teach) Julia?

Julia pros over MATLAB:

  • unicode characters = looks like math
  • effortless functions defined in scripts
  • broadcast syntax for elementwise apply
  • comprehensions
  • easy to define keyword and optional function arguments
  • part of Jupyter
  • free and open-source
  • skills more likely to transfer